M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=us-ascii References: <3E2753C9 DOT 4040008 AT kleckner DOT net>, <3E25A7EE DOT 7050109 AT kleckner DOT net> > After carefully inspecting the symbols from > generated dlls and dlls provided by TradeStation, > I found that symbols occurred with and without the > @decorations. e.g. PPI AT 4 and PPI. > > Adding -Wl,--add-stdcall-alias to the gcc line, > all worked fine. > > Could this generally be a requirement for dlls > that are opened at runtime in a fashion similar to > dlopen? If so, then some FAQ annotation would be > in order here: > http://www.cygwin.com/cygwin-ug-net/dll.html I may be wrong (I'm not a GCC expert), but isn't that more of a gcc thing than a cygwin thing? I don't want to end up pasting the whole gcc manual into the "Using DLLs" page. It's really only intended to be a quick start for cygwin, not a comprehensive guide. __________________________________________________ Do you Yahoo!? Yahoo! Mail Plus - Powerful. Affordable.
